Analysis

In 2025, individual liberties and equality before the law index in Saudi Arabia stood at 0.199.

That represents a change of down 2.5% on the previous year and up 5.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, individual liberties and equality before the law index in Saudi Arabia peaked at 0.204 in 2024 and was at its lowest, 0.054, in 1822.

Saudi Arabia ranks 161st of 176 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 237 years of available data.
